  • Patent number: 5047908
    Abstract: A lighting fitting designed to operate either in the spotlight or flood mode has a reflector (7) extending forwardly of the lamp (1) and comprising a plurality of segments (8A, 8B) pivotable about respective axes (12) which are tangential to a circle centred on the longitudinal axis (X) of the reflector (7). Each segment comprises two longitudinally separate sections (8A, 8B) associated with arms (16) for pivoting them simultaneously but through different angles.

  • Patent number: 4677338
    Abstract: In a lamp having at least one seal of solid light-transmitting material, in which is embedded at least one current-supply foil, visible, I.R. and U.V. radiations which would otherwise be internally reflected from the seal surface are dispersed by providing on the seal either a non-uniform surface region or a light-dispersive coating, thus reducing the temperature of the outer ends of the foil and thereby reducing the risk of failure caused by oxidation. The seal may be formed with ribs or sand blasted or it may be provided with a coating of glass containing reflective particles or gas bubbles.

  • Patent number: 4550269
    Abstract: In a high pressure electric discharge lamp employing at least one ribbon seal incorporating a strip (3) of refractory metal foil extending through the wall of an envelope (1) of fused silica, and connected at its outer end to at least one external lead rod (5) and at its inner end to a rod (4) which constitutes or provides a support for an electrode of the lamp, with the foil and adjacent ends of the lead rod or rods and the electrode embedded in the envelope wall, wherein a said lead rod and/or an electrode rod is surrounded, over at least a part of the region of the rod which is embedded in the envelope wall, by a closely wound coil (6) of a relatively thin refractory metal wire. This enables the fused silica of the envelope to be pressed tightly around the rod in that region in manufacture while reducing the tendency to crack on cooling.
